What is the International Space Station?

The International Space Station (ISS) is a habitable artificial satellite that orbits the Earth at an altitude of approximately 408 kilometers (253 miles). It is a joint project between five space agencies: NASA (United States), Roscosmos (Russia), JAXA (Japan), ESA (Europe), and CSA (Canada). The ISS is the largest man-made object in space and it is also the most expensive object ever built, with a total cost of over $150 billion.

How was the ISS built?

The construction of the ISS began in 1998 with the launch of the Russian module Zarya. Over the next 12 years, more than 40 space missions were conducted to assemble the ISS in orbit. The modules of the ISS were built by various space agencies and then transported to the ISS by spacecraft such as the Russian Soyuz and Progress and the American Space Shuttle. The ISS has a mass of approximately 419,725 kilograms (925,335 pounds) and it spans an area of 108.5 meters (356 feet) from end to end.

Who lives on the ISS?

The ISS is typically inhabited by a crew of six astronauts or cosmonauts, who live and work on the station for periods of approximately six months at a time. Since its first permanent crew arrived in 2000, the ISS has been continuously occupied by humans. Over the years, astronauts and cosmonauts from 19 different countries have lived on the ISS.

What is life like on the ISS?

Life on the ISS is far from easy. Astronauts and cosmonauts have to deal with a number of challenges, including microgravity, radiation, and a limited supply of food, water, and oxygen. However, they are also able to conduct scientific research in a unique environment that is free from the effects of gravity. They also have access to stunning views of the Earth and the stars.

What kind of research is conducted on the ISS?

The ISS is used as a laboratory for a wide range of scientific research. Some of the areas of research include biology, physics, and materials science. The microgravity environment of the ISS allows scientists to conduct experiments that cannot be conducted on Earth. For example, scientists have been able to study the effects of microgravity on the human body, which has helped to improve our understanding of the human immune system, bone and muscle loss, and other medical conditions.

How is the ISS powered?

The ISS is powered by an array of solar panels that cover an area of about 2,500 square meters (27,000 square feet). The solar panels generate electricity that is used to power the systems and equipment on the station, including the life-support systems, communication systems, and scientific instruments.

How long will the ISS continue to operate?

The current plan is for the ISS to continue operating until at least 2024. However, there have been discussions about extending its lifespan until 2028 or beyond. Ultimately, the future of the ISS will depend on a number of factors, including the availability of funding and the willingness of the participating space agencies to continue supporting the project.
